What is an "avadavat"?

An avadavat, also known as the strawberry finch or red munia, is a small and captivating bird native to the Indian subcontinent and parts of Southeast Asia. With its vibrant plumage, the avadavat stands out with its bright red feathers, while the male boasts striking black markings on its face and upper body. These birds are typically found in grasslands, fields, and cultivated areas, where they forage on seeds, grains, and small insects. Avadavats are highly social creatures and are often seen in small flocks, exhibiting playful behavior and engaging in courtship displays.
